Love Me Love Me Not Graphic Novel Volume 01
"Fast friends Yuna and Akari are complete opposites-Yuna is an idealist, while Akari is a realist. When lady-killer Rio and the oblivious Kazuomi join their ranks, love and friendship become quite complicated! For teen audiences. "
